Analysis
In 2018, total fao — veneer sheets — import value in Suriname stood at 38 1000 USD.
That represents a change of up 171.4% on the previous year and up 137.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, total fao — veneer sheets — import value in Suriname peaked at 1,560 1000 USD in 2010 and was at its lowest, 0 1000 USD, in 2000.
That places Suriname 136th out of 169 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
